Output 676896759016b333765799b259e8de48cab1afe04efed6158a4d830958ec6fe9:27

value
441486
script pubkey
OP_0 OP_PUSHBYTES_20 9649cbe09e9d2677b4eef628a5b879e19ea1f257
address
bc1qjeyuhcy7n5n80d8w7c52twreux02rujhatx0ux
transaction
676896759016b333765799b259e8de48cab1afe04efed6158a4d830958ec6fe9